#837175 Hex color

#837175

The hexadecimal color code #837175 corresponds to the code RGB( 131, 113, 117 ). It's a shade of Gray. This color is a combination of red (at 0,51 level), green (at 0,44 level) and blue (at 0,46 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 7%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 31% and blue at 32%.
